commit:     99dc82f53e80b660f4d8afdb506b3b970e45a72d
Author:     David Heidelberg <david <AT> ixit <DOT> cz>
AuthorDate: Fri Nov 21 13:55:24 2014 +0000
Commit:     David Heidelberger <d.okias <AT> gmail <DOT> com>
CommitDate: Fri Nov 21 13:55:24 2014 +0000
URL:        http://sources.gentoo.org/gitweb/?p=proj/x11.git;a=commit;h=99dc82f5

media-libs/mesa: drop openvg support

configure: error: Cannot enable OpenVG, because egl_gallium has been removed and
                  OpenVG hasn't been integrated into standard libEGL yet

Signed-off-by: David Heidelberg <david <AT> ixit.cz>

---
 media-libs/mesa/mesa-9999.ebuild | 4 +---
 media-libs/mesa/metadata.xml     | 1 -
 2 files changed, 1 insertion(+), 4 deletions(-)

diff --git a/media-libs/mesa/mesa-9999.ebuild b/media-libs/mesa/mesa-9999.ebuild
index e9f0800..4120974 100644
--- a/media-libs/mesa/mesa-9999.ebuild
+++ b/media-libs/mesa/mesa-9999.ebuild
@@ -50,13 +50,12 @@ done
 
 IUSE="${IUSE_VIDEO_CARDS}
        bindist +classic d3d9 debug +dri3 +egl +gallium +gbm gles1 gles2 +llvm
-       +nptl opencl openvg osmesa pax_kernel openmax pic r600-llvm-compiler 
selinux
+       +nptl opencl osmesa pax_kernel openmax pic r600-llvm-compiler selinux
        vaapi vdpau wayland xvmc xa kernel_FreeBSD"
 
 REQUIRED_USE="
        d3d9? ( gallium dri3 )
        llvm?   ( gallium )
-       openvg? ( egl gallium )
        opencl? (
                gallium
                video_cards_r600? ( r600-llvm-compiler )
@@ -258,7 +257,6 @@ multilib_src_configure() {
                myconf+="
                        $(use_enable d3d9 nine)
                        $(use_enable llvm gallium-llvm)
-                       $(use_enable openvg)
                        $(use_enable openmax omx)
                        $(use_enable r600-llvm-compiler)
                        $(use_enable vaapi va)

diff --git a/media-libs/mesa/metadata.xml b/media-libs/mesa/metadata.xml
index 69cb2f1..625b06b 100644
--- a/media-libs/mesa/metadata.xml
+++ b/media-libs/mesa/metadata.xml
@@ -15,7 +15,6 @@
        <flag name='llvm'>Enable LLVM backend for Gallium3D.</flag>
        <flag name='opencl'>Enable the Clover Gallium OpenCL state 
tracker.</flag>
        <flag name='openmax'>Enable OpenMAX video decode/encode acceleration 
for Gallium3D.</flag>
-       <flag name='openvg'>Enable the OpenVG 2D acceleration API for 
Gallium3D.</flag>
        <flag name='osmesa'>Build the Mesa library for off-screen 
rendering.</flag>
        <flag name='pax_kernel'>Enable if the user plans to run the package 
under a pax enabled hardened kernel</flag>
        <flag name='pic'>disable optimized assembly code that is not PIC 
friendly</flag>

Reply via email to